Vendor note for new team members: canary gating on the Bramblewick platform is enforced by our vendor, Opaline Systems, not by us. Their Gatewright tool holds each canary at 5% traffic until error rate, latency p95, and saturation all pass for 30 minutes. We cannot override the hold; only Opaline's release desk can. Document any gating dispute in the vendor log before requesting an exception. For exception requests, write to their release desk directly.

alerts address for bahaf-kaduf: zorox@qorvelio.internal

Subject: DR Drill Friday — Crumbline Cutoff Service

On-call: Friday 06:00 we run the disaster-recovery drill for Crumbline, the bakery order-cutoff service. Scenario: primary region down, cutoff rule engine restored from snapshot. Verify the 14:00 next-day cutoff rule fires correctly post-restore; wholesale orders must still reject after cutoff. Keep the incident channel updated every 15 minutes. Failback by 08:00 or escalate. The restored rules vault will prompt for operator unlock; use the recovery passphrase below.

unlock words, tawif-tahop: oliys-ulawyn-tamdor-lamys-casox-jormir-fraius-kasath-ulador-ulamir-holir-sorys-holeth

Runbook: Torvane session-token refresh bug. Tokens expire mid-request when refresh fires within 5s of TTL. Workaround: bump refresh skew in auth-proxy and restart the Torvane gateway pods. Root cause fix lands next sprint per Marda's branch. Do not toggle sticky sessions; it masks the symptom. Current production settings for reference are as follows.

deployment values, kajep-kageg:
[praix]
host = praix.paliqcorp.corp
user = praix_svc
database = praix_prod

14:22 — Offline sync regression confirmed (Terrapath field-survey app)

At 14:22 the on-call engineer reproduced the data-loss path: surveys saved while offline were marked synced once connectivity returned, even when the upload was rejected. The queue flush skipped the server acknowledgement check introduced in the previous sprint. Release manager note: the fix must ship before the coastal survey season. The offending build is identified by the token recorded below.

session token of kawif-fawig = htk31_f3f599be2b1a34affb1efa8d0feccf8